The half life of a substance is 20 minutes The time interval between 33% decay and 67% decay |
|
Answer» Solution :For 33% decay, `N/(N_0)=1/(2^(n_1))implies 1/(100) = 1/(2^(n_1)) .....(1)"" n_(1) = t_(1)/T` For 67% decay , `N/N_(0) = 1/(2^(n_2)) implies 33/100 = 1/(2^(n_2)).....(2)` `n_(2) = t_(2)/T` `((2))/((1))=33/67=1/(2^((n_(2)-n_(1))))implies1//2^(1)=1/(2((t_(2)-t_(1)))/T)implies(t_(2)-t_(1))/T=1` `t_(2)-t_(1) = T = 20 ` minutes. |
